Applications
Amyl oleate (CAS 142-57-4) is used primarily in fragrance applications as an odorant and fixative component in perfumery, contributing fruity-oleaginous notes and helping stabilize aroma blends. In cosmetics and personal care, it often serves as a solvent and carrier oil, aiding fragrance delivery and functioning as an emollient in lotions, creams, and other scented formulations. It may also be employed as a processing aid or plasticizer in certain polymer and coating systems, imparting flexibility and influencing texture. In household products and cleaning formulations, it can act as a solvent or fragrance carrier to assist formulation performance. In industrial manufacturing, amyl oleate is used as a non-volatile solvent or diluent for active ingredients and as a medium for fragrance loading; it may also appear as an intermediate in fragrance compound synthesis. Subject to local regulations and formulation limits.
